Alice B. Evans

 

Alice Breazeale Evans, 94, widow of John Stephen Evans, went home to be with the Lord on Thursday, August 31, 2023 at Baptist Easley Hospital surrounded by her family and friends.

Born in Lebanon Community, outside of Pendleton, SC, Anderson County, SC. Alice was the daughter of the late John Allen Breazeale and Alma Othella Smith Breazeale. She graduated from the Anderson Hospital Nursing Program, becoming an RN in 1949. She and John spent five years in Cuba after which they returned to Clemson where she worked in the General Practice of Dr. Robert Burley. She retired from nursing when her children came along and she loved being at home for them.

Alice was a dedicated Christian who shared her love of Christ at every opportunity. She had a sweet spirit of compassion and love as she helped family and friends. Her love for cooking was enjoyed by many generations of family, friends, and Clemson students through church functions and Clemson football games. For those who were privileged to receive them, her annual Christmas cookie assortment highlighted her love and compassion. She was a Clemson fan through and through, and watched her Tigers win or lose. She was a dedicated member of Oconee Presbyterian Church in Seneca, SC.

Alice is survived by her son, John Marion Evans of New Zion, SC; Daughter, Alma Alice Evans of Clemson, SC; nephews and nieces as well as great and great great nephews and nieces.

In addition to her husband and parents, Alice was preceded in death by brothers Kennon Smith Breazeale, John Allen Breazeale Jr., and James Oliver Breazeale.
